DJ, from what I can see, the cylinder looks good. Some of the cross hatching is even still visible. That being said, you could still have leakage past the piston rings which isn't going to be visible, and aside from pulling the piston out and doing some measuring there's no way to tell at this stage of tear down. You mentioned you will be sending the block out, what are your plans?

As long as your cams are stock, they are technically interchangeable, and can be installed in any order. I personally like to note which cam is the intake and which is the exhaust, and put them back in the head just like they were removed. That way, if either cam has worn to the cam journals in any particular way it will "match" its journals when reinstalled.

When you put the cams back in the head and torque the cam caps, without a timing belt on, the valves will be in a relaxed state for the most part. When you start moving the cams to line up timing marks (after the head is installed on the block), make sure none of the pistons are at TDC. Once you get your cam timing marks lined up, slowly rotate the crank by hand to line its timing marks up. It's pretty hard to bend a valve by hand, but it can be done. Just be cautious and take your time.

That test won't really tell you anything. At this point, the only way to tell if the piston rings are worn is to further disassemble the block, remove the pistons, and measure everything.

Without the head installed, you won't be able to perform a cylinder leakdown test, which would have told you if the piston rings were leaking/worn.

You can rotate the crank to your heart's desire. You will have to re-time the engine when you reinstall the head anyways, so worrying about timing marks at this point is moot.

GST, you are a tad off base on the stock cams, the intake cam has a slot in the back of it the CAS mates to. The exhaust cam dose not have that slot.


Now the oil test could give him an indicator if the rings are bad off, if the #2 cylinder leaked more oil past the rings than #1,3,4 It is by no means the most accurate way to tell, but can give a hint if the pistons need to come out.
 
Once you figure it out it wont be hard to put it all together again. You pull the head so once your ready to install it make sure you replace things in question timing components.
 
I recently pulled the head on my tsi that was leaking oil down the front side of the block, turned out, looking at the exhaust side, the valve stem seals were leaking a good amount of oil and the turbo was on the way out. Those two combined or even just very worn valve stem seals can result in that sort of "sludge" forming on the block. Just my .02

Also, if the oil and coolant looked clean, the coolant near the p/s area could just be the water pipe o-ring leaking from the water pump or something simple like that. Nothing a new w/p wouldn't solve.

HG looks OK to me. The fire rings are in good shape, not distorted. From the pictures of the block you posted, it looks like they were sealing fine there as well. Looks like a normal, used HG. Can't really say where you are loosing compression on cylinder 2, but it doesn't appear that a faulty head gasket is to blame.
 
Post a close up pic of the head surface, if that was improperly done, the HG would not be to blame, but the surface on the head.

I will agree, I can not see a fail point in the HG either.
 
I have a method I use to test for cylinder leakage without the head. I use a vacuum pump with a plate that fits over the cylinder. It has a nice gauge on it so you can count with a stopwatches and estimate the leakage precisely. I use the same method for testing valves, except with a different plate. You could do the same with positive pressure if you want, but you would need to clamp the plate to the block, or bolt it. It is just a flat piece of steel with a nipple threaded into it and a rubber seal glued to the other side.
